Power communication station patrol optimization method
Technical Field
The invention relates to a power grid equipment maintenance method, which can be used in the field of power communication industry, in particular to a power communication station inspection optimization method.
Background
Along with the continuous development of a power grid, the number of operation and maintenance power communication stations and equipment is increased by operation and maintenance personnel and people, at present, all stations and equipment are managed according to a standard in a maintenance mode, stations are inspected in a patrol mode one by one, the stations are inspected in a patrol mode without primary and secondary inspection, important stations do not perform key patrol, the reliability of the station equipment is reduced, the patrol period of partial stations is too short, and patrol resources are wasted.
The existing patrol system or method does not perform differentiation and hierarchical management on communication stations, and resources cannot be divided according to actual needs, so that the maintenance pressure of the power communication station is high, and the maintenance efficiency is low.

Disclosure of Invention
The invention provides a patrol optimization method for an electric power communication station, which is used for solving the problem that the patrol efficiency of the existing communication station is poor.
The invention is realized by the following technical scheme:
a patrol optimization method for a power communication station comprises the following steps:
s1, analyzing the reliability of the local power communication station through a multiple linear regression formula, wherein the multiple linear regression formula is that s is β01x12x2+…βnxn
Wherein S is a risk degree score of the local power communication site, β0、β1、β2、…、βnAs a multiple linear regression parameter, x1、x2、…、xnFactors influencing the operation reliability of the station;
obtaining regression parameters by calculating and fitting through SPSS, substituting the regression parameters into a multiple linear regression formula, and further obtaining a reliability formula;
s2, substituting information of all power communication stations in the local area into a reliability formula to calculate to obtain each power communicationRisk degree score of credit site: s1、s2、…、sn
S3, arranging all the electric power communication stations according to the risk degree scores, and determining the number of the stations needing operation and maintenance through a threshold score S';
s4, electric power communication station P with maximum score0Calculating the electric power communication station and the station P with the risk degree score larger than S' by taking the geographic coordinate as the center0The distance between the power communication stations is less than a set distance threshold value L, and the risk degree score is greater than S', and the power communication stations are put into a set C ═ P0,P1,…,Pn};
S5, acquiring the number N of inspection stations;
and S6, after the patrol is finished, updating the patrol time, changing the score of the power communication station by adjusting the factors influencing the station operation reliability, and returning to the step S2.
According to the power communication station tour optimization method, the factors influencing the operation reliability of the station include but are not limited to station classification, operation time, pollution level and last tour time parameter.
According to the method for optimizing patrol of the electric power communication stations, the first N electric power communication stations in the set C are taken from large to small according to the risk degree score, and when the number of the electric power communication stations in the set C is smaller than N, all the electric power communication stations in the set C are patrolled.
According to the method for optimizing the patrol of the power communication station, the range of the distance threshold value L is between 5 and 20 Km.
According to the electric power communication station tour optimization method, the score S' ranges from 60 to 90.

Specifically, the explanation will be given by taking 21 power communication stations in south-johnson of Shandong as an example.
1. The maintenance period of the power communication station is related to various factors such as station classification, operation time, pollution level and last inspection time, and the reliability of the power communication station is analyzed by using a multiple linear regression formula. The stations in table 1 all reach a state requiring patrol.
TABLE 1 site situation Table
Figure BDA0001681115610000051
Wherein, the common voltage classes comprise four classes of 500kV, 220kV, 110kV and 35kV, and the values are respectively set as 4, 3, 2 and 1; common levels of contamination range from heavy to light values of 5, 4, 3, 2, 1.
TABLE 2 results of multiple Linear regression analysis Coefficientsa
Figure BDA0001681115610000061
Performing multiple linear regression analysis by using SPSS software to obtain regression parameter values:
β0=13.207,β1=10.307,β2=5.180,β3=0.353,β4when the power station reliability is 0.343, the final power station reliability formula is:
the S-13.207 +10.307 × voltage level +5.180 × pollution level +0.353 × run time +0.343 × distance last round trip time.
2. All 21 sites were scored using the above reliability formula and ranked from top to bottom, resulting in table 3 below.
Meanwhile, screening is carried out by using a set threshold score S' of 85.
TABLE 3 site Risk level score
Site name Score of Site name Score of Site name Score of Site name Score of
P2 95 P16 83 P0 73 P9 66
P13 95 P8 79 P20 72 P7 65
P10 94 P1 75 P4 71 P11 60
P3 91 P5 81 P12 70
P6 88 P14 81 P15 69
P18 86 P17 80 P19 67
The threshold value score S' ranges from 60 to 90, and the number of all power communication stations in a local area and the patrol workload are comprehensively adjusted.
3. Station P with the largest score2Finding the distance P by taking the geographic coordinate as the center2And (5) putting the stations with the scores larger than S' and smaller than L & lt10 km into a set C & ltC & gt & ltP & gt & lt/P & gt according to the score values2,P10,P6,Pn18}. And adjusting the distance threshold value L within the range of 5-20 Km by integrating the number of all power communication stations in the local area and the inspection workload.
4. Comprehensively inspecting the workload requirement, acquiring the number N of the electric power communication stations to be inspected to be 4, and then aligning to { P2,P10,P6,Pn18And inspecting the 4 power communication stations.
5. And updating the patrol time of the patrol station, recalculating the risk degree scores of all the electric power communication stations in the region, and returning to the step 2.
